About The Position

The Lead Administrative Assistant is responsible for providing high-level administrative support to a group of three Vice Presidents and their teams within the Supply Chain division. This role reports directly to the Team Lead, Admin Assistant, and serves as a key point of coordination and communication for the leadership team.

Requirements

  • Minimum of 2 years of experience in an administrative support role, ideally supporting senior leadership.
  • Associate’s degree or equivalent combination of education and experience.
  • Exceptional verbal and written communication skills.
  • Strong organizational abilities and a commitment to outstanding customer service.
  • Demonstrated accountability, independence, and keen attention to detail.
  • Proven basic project management skills.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ite, Concur, and Ariba platforms.
  • Ability to exercise sound judgment and handle confidential information with discretion.
  • Proactive, strategic thinker who can adapt to changing priorities and anticipate the needs of the team.

Responsibilities

  • Deliver comprehensive administrative support to 3–4 Vice Presidents, managing diverse needs and priorities.
  • Coordinate complex travel arrangements, manage calendars, and handle daily meeting logistics for assigned VPs.
  • Prepare, review, and submit expense reports accurately and in a timely manner.
  • Organize meetings with internal and external stakeholders across various international time zones.
  • Demonstrate flexibility and responsiveness to requests and meetings that may occur outside standard business hours.
  • Create, edit, and distribute reports, presentations, and internal communications as required by the team.
  • Plan, coordinate, and execute departmental events and meetings, ensuring all logistics are managed seamlessly.
  • Process and track invoices, ensuring correct coding and timely approval in accordance with company policies.
  • Provide back-up assistance to other admin team members as needed, fostering strong team collaboration.
  • Manage departmental supplies, equipment, and resources to support efficient operations.
  • Assist with additional administrative projects and assignments as directed by the Team Leader, Executive Assistant.
